A unique tiny house community has emerged in a remote, undisclosed location in the United States, offering a glimpse into an alternative living model. The community, showcased in a recent video by Troy Ulshoeffer, features multiple small, self-contained homes, illuminated by various outdoor lighting, including string lights and ground-level fixtures. Outdoor common areas with seating are also visible, fostering a communal atmosphere. Residents appear to embrace a minimalist lifestyle, living off the land in a setting described as a "Tiny House city from scratch in the middle of nowhere." The video highlights the aesthetic and functional aspects of this burgeoning community, attracting considerable interest from those exploring sustainable and independent living solutions.
